Qeshlaq-e Anuch, Hamadan, Iran

Overview

Qeshlaq-e Anuch is a small rural village in Hamadan province, Iran, known for its warm hospitality, agricultural surroundings, and tranquil lifestyle. The village is enveloped by beautiful countryside and offers insight into traditional Persian rural life.

Best Time to Visit

April-June and September-October for mild and pleasant weather.

Local Tips

English is rare; consider traveling with a Farsi-speaking guide. Cash is important since card payments are uncommon in rural areas.

Cultural Etiquette

Dress modestly, especially women (hair and arms covered). Tipping is appreciated in eateries and taxis but not mandatory. Ask permission before photographing locals.

Safety Warnings

Qeshlaq-e Anuch is generally very safe; petty crime is almost unheard of. Roads may be poorly lit at night, drive carefully and avoid traveling after dark if possible.

Hidden Gems

Walk the country lanes at sunrise for spectacular views, or visit the small shrine on the village outskirts for a quiet moment with panoramic vistas.
